Web24 jul. 2024 · Children 14 and 15 are allowed a limited amount of work. They can't work at all during school hours, and during the school year, they're limited to 15 hours per week. Once school is out for summer or vacations, these children are allowed to work up to eight hours a day and up to 40 hours per week. WebNightwork restrictions set limits on how late a minor can legally work. For Minors Under 16: Work is prohibited during these hours: 9:30 p.m. (11 p.m. before non-school day) to 6 a.m. 7 p.m. to 6 a.m. in door-to-door sales or deliveries.
